Add the compose_stack role, inventory and playbooks
One role that syncs a payload and brings the stack up, configured entirely through stack_* variables, plus six playbooks that each demonstrate one part of that contract. Every playbook runs standalone and is tagged with its stack name, so site.yml --tags <stack> works.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 5 (1M context) <[email protected]>
